Re: [RFC PATCH V1] raid5: Add R5_ReadNoMerge flag which prevent bio from merging at block layer

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



On Fri, 13 Jul 2012 19:13:35 +0800 majianpeng <majianpeng@xxxxxxxxx> wrote:

> Because bios will merge at block-layer,so bios-error may caused by other
> bio which be merged into to the same request.
> Using this flag,it will find exactly error-sector and not do redundant
> operation like re-write and re-read.
> 
> V0->V1:Using REQ_FLUSH instead REQ_NOMERGE avoid bio merging at block
> layer.

Thanks, I've applied this.

We should probably do a similar thing in fix_read_error and
fix_sync_read_error in RAID1 and RAID10...
